Welcome to the site for the 2011 QuAMP meeting. QuAMP is one of a series of biennial meetings of the Division of Atomic, Molecular, Optical and Plasma Physics of the Institute of Physics.

This international conference will cover a range of AMOP physics including:
  • Ultracold matter
  • Quantum information and computing
  • Ultrafast phenomena
  • Coherent control
  • Metrology
  • Plasma physics
  • Atomic and molecular interactions
The conference will be held in the University of Oxford Physics Department, and at Balliol College, Oxford.

The conference registration and accommodation will be highly subsidized for students, with a special further discount for the first 50 students to register.
